)]}'
{"/COMMIT_MSG":[{"author":{"_account_id":15435,"name":"Al Bailey","email":"albailey1974@gmail.com","username":"albailey"},"change_message_id":"b5feb533c2fc602043253334f4d6e17ca344efc5","unresolved":true,"context_lines":[{"line_number":10,"context_line":"support kickstarts to avoid processing installer RPMs"},{"line_number":11,"context_line":"in future releases."},{"line_number":12,"context_line":""},{"line_number":13,"context_line":"This change introudces a new sysinv API to query if an"},{"line_number":14,"context_line":"upgrade is in progress (i.e, upgrade starts, but not"},{"line_number":15,"context_line":"abort)."},{"line_number":16,"context_line":""}],"source_content_type":"text/x-gerrit-commit-message","patch_set":2,"id":"3f7710b0_bf5fbe65","line":13,"range":{"start_line":13,"start_character":12,"end_line":13,"end_character":23},"updated":"2022-02-18 20:50:03.000000000","message":"introduces","commit_id":"a75469c23c67f94a4d87642c6676db09301d7eff"},{"author":{"_account_id":28466,"name":"Bin Qian","email":"bin.qian@windriver.com","username":"bqian"},"change_message_id":"0119ffaa62bc84350c5dd8f3e74c8d27135c6166","unresolved":false,"context_lines":[{"line_number":10,"context_line":"support kickstarts to avoid processing installer RPMs"},{"line_number":11,"context_line":"in future releases."},{"line_number":12,"context_line":""},{"line_number":13,"context_line":"This change introudces a new sysinv API to query if an"},{"line_number":14,"context_line":"upgrade is in progress (i.e, upgrade starts, but not"},{"line_number":15,"context_line":"abort)."},{"line_number":16,"context_line":""}],"source_content_type":"text/x-gerrit-commit-message","patch_set":2,"id":"93f1b3b8_0ac2f922","line":13,"range":{"start_line":13,"start_character":12,"end_line":13,"end_character":23},"in_reply_to":"3f7710b0_bf5fbe65","updated":"2022-02-18 21:29:45.000000000","message":"Done","commit_id":"a75469c23c67f94a4d87642c6676db09301d7eff"}],"/PATCHSET_LEVEL":[{"author":{"_account_id":15435,"name":"Al Bailey","email":"albailey1974@gmail.com","username":"albailey"},"change_message_id":"b5feb533c2fc602043253334f4d6e17ca344efc5","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":2,"id":"08f4b504_85886d65","updated":"2022-02-18 20:50:03.000000000","message":"I assume you noticed the in_upgrade API that was already there.\nIt looks to me like the only difference is that you added 2 extra states to declare \u0027false\u0027, but all other states would be the same.\n\nAlso curious why your boolean logic is essentially the opposite as the existing method, while yielding the same true/false for all but 2 states.","commit_id":"a75469c23c67f94a4d87642c6676db09301d7eff"},{"author":{"_account_id":28466,"name":"Bin Qian","email":"bin.qian@windriver.com","username":"bqian"},"change_message_id":"0119ffaa62bc84350c5dd8f3e74c8d27135c6166","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":2,"id":"52b0d41f_b9c8500a","in_reply_to":"08f4b504_85886d65","updated":"2022-02-18 21:29:45.000000000","message":"This new api is not the same scope as the existing one. The current query is to distinguish where upgrade is \"started and moving forward\".\nmy preference is when it makes sense, clearly define positive return (\"what is\"), and leave negative return (\"what is not\") in otherwise.","commit_id":"a75469c23c67f94a4d87642c6676db09301d7eff"}]}
